Investing in renewable energy Projects in Ukraine

On 31 July 2020 the Law No. 810-IX  dated 21 July 2020 (based on the Draft Law No. 3658 dated 15 June 2020)  On Introduction of Amendments to Certain Laws of Ukraine as to Improvement of Conditions of Support for Production of Electricity from Alternative Energy Sources  (the “Law”) was signed by the President of Ukraine and officially published.

Solar forecasting in Ukraine

Weather systems result in strong variability in the available solar radiation across the day. This means that solar plant power output is impacted, with strong changes in energy generation across the day. As Ukraine adds more solar energy to its electricity grid, it is becoming important to predict these changes in energy generation from hours to days ahead.
